Transaction 645c11559bb91aeb61a0ee242dd023cc8e50d5a61170ba4ad9398032c1e39fb1

1 Input
2 Outputs
  • 645c11559bb91aeb61a0ee242dd023cc8e50d5a61170ba4ad9398032c1e39fb1:0
  • value  5231013
    address  1DECJfr3KxFWMZ2ngDZbayRCR1EgeF2rYN
  • 645c11559bb91aeb61a0ee242dd023cc8e50d5a61170ba4ad9398032c1e39fb1:1
  • value  109885037
    address  3NaWAEE3zSUNHea3sTtMeFruWeyftVGrZY